No Arrests After Yelewata Massacre Lecturer Rages

Dr John Ogi teaches at Moses Orshio Adasu University in Makurdi. He worries about the lack of arrests after the Yelewata community attack that killed over 200 people. President Bola Tinubu visited Benue State Wednesday and asked why police had not caught anyone. The university lecturer posted his concerns on Facebook after the presidential meeting. He saw many security officers around Makurdi but no suspects were arrested.

Ogi questions what officials know about who caused the killings or paid for them. He wants to see real action instead of just meetings and conversations. The lecturer asks if the presidential visit will start proper investigations or just mark the end of discussions. He wonders why a president must visit before security forces do their jobs properly. Ogi points out that these attacks have happened for a long time before this presidential trip.
